A Guide to the Leagues and Cups of English Football

Premier League (level 1, 20 teams): The bottom three teams are relegated.English Football League Championship (level 2, 24 teams): Top two automatically promoted; next four compete in the play-offs, with the winner gaining the third promotion spot.
